Afcon 2025: Lookman Not Interested In Individual Honours

Ademola Lookman has said he is not thinking about winning the Most Valuable Player, MVP, or top scorer award at the 2025 Africa Cup of Nations, DAILY POST reports.

Lookman has clearly emerged as one of the leading candidates for both awards after impressing in three outings for the Super Eagles in Morocco.

The 28-year-old has already scored three goals and registered five assists for Éric Chelle’s side in the competition.

Only Morocco’s playmaker Brahim Diaz (four) has scored more goals than him at AFCON 2025.

The 28-year-old, however, has more goals involvements than any other player in the competition.

Lookman already earned a place in Group Stage Best X1.

The winger stated that his main focus is for the team to win the title.

“Personally I’m just thinking about the team, now we are in the quarter-finals our next opponent is going to be another strong team. We scored four goals, another big performance for the team so that’s what I care about,” he said after Nigeria’s win against Mozambique.
